Firefighters released a woman who was ‘trapped inside’ a vehicle following a crash on Winchester Road that saw a Ford Focus end up on the bonnet of another car.

Firefighters, police, and an ambulance were all pictured at the scene.

In a statement, a spokesperson for Hampshire and Isle of Wight Fire and Rescue Service, told the Echo: “Redbridge and Hightown crews were called to a road traffic collision in a car park on Winchester Road shortly before 3pm on Saturday, October 14.

“Firefighters worked to stabilise the vehicle before releasing a woman trapped inside who was passed to paramedics for assessment.

“Hampshire and Isle of Wight Fire and Rescue Service left the scene following the stop message at 3.18pm.”

A spokesperson for Hampshire Police had already confirmed that “no injuries were reported’, following the incident.

A fence appears to have been damaged in the incident as onlookers were pictured looking in amazement.
